SAFM Market Update: Cross Trainer Enters Business Rescue
Dr. Eric Levenstein, Director and Head of our Insolvency & Business Rescue practice area, had a discussion with Jimmy Moyaha of SAFM about the markets reaction to Cross Trainer going under business rescue and the current status of the business rescue mechanism in South Africa.
